Is There a New Game Plus System in Lies of P? 

To address this question directly, yes, Lies of P indeed incorporates a New Game Plus system, much like its relatives, the SoulsBorne titles. New Game Plus, often abbreviated as NG+, for Lies of P, is an unlockable game feature that allows players to embark on a new playthrough after meeting the requirement of completing the main campaign at least once.

In most cases, engaging in New Game Plus enables players to commence the main storyline from the beginning while retaining certain elements acquired during their initial playthrough. These retained elements typically include player level, unlocked skills, discovered items, resources, equipment, and more.

However, not all significant components of the game will carry over, such as Key Items that are crucial for specific points in the game. While our game completion status is still pending, we anticipate that this feature serves not only to emphasize the game's multiple endings (as confirmed by the developer) but also offers players an opportunity to experiment with various weapons and items they may not have tried during their initial playthrough.

One aspect we have yet to confirm is the increase in difficulty in New Game Plus. If you've played any of the Souls-like games before, you're likely aware that advancing into New Game Plus and subsequent iterations, such as NG2 and NG3, typically results in more robust enemies, as well as increased rewards like Souls.

We anticipate that the New Game Plus modes in Lies of P will operate similarly, with enemy strength, health, and the Ergo currency drops all seeing an increase. This aligns with the fact that your player character will also have attained a higher level and should be capable of handling the increased challenge.
